ACT offers indexable carbide insert engraving tools as productive alternative to solid carbide

Advanced Carbide Tooling (ACT) has developed tools for high quality and high definition marking and engraving that have indexable carbide inserts as a cost and time efficient alternative to solid carbide engraving tools.

As an addition to ACT's Nine 9 series, the universal marking tools are suitable for engraving any character or numeral that can be created by an NC program. Available with either a 45º or 60º insert angle, the series can be used for marking serial numbers, product codes, dial scales, signs, logos or any other characters. The four insert geometries in the ACT range, available with a TiN or TiAlN coating, are suitable for engraving a wide variety of materials from aluminium, plastics and non-ferrous materials through to carbon, stainless and hardened steels and cast irons. A geometry design that is fully ground on the periphery ensures repeatability and eliminates burrs. The engraving tools have a high positive rake angle and are capable of running at speeds up to 20,000 rpm and feedrates of 0.08 mm/rev. The 2 mm-thick, two cutting edge inserts incorporate a 6 mm long cutting face for engraving at increased depths and are available with a 0.1 or 0.2 mm corner radius. The inserts are complemented by rigid and robust toolholders that eliminate vibration and provide superior surface finishes at high speeds and feeds. The round shank toolholders are available in 6 mm diameter with lengths of 40, 60 and 100 mm for extended reach applications. The toolholders are also available with the option of steel shank or solid carbide shank for further enhanced rigidity.
